Are they the remastered versions?
No, they’re the originals. However, as the DVD Details article Digital Delight says, the series has undergone a more traditional DVNR (Digital Vision Noise Reduction) cleaning up from the original one-inch tapes, to remove blemishes and improve picture quality. The sound has also been cleaned up. As to why the remastered versions weren’t released, Doug says in his Film Force interview: “…that is what the fans wanted.
